Scoring system to evaluate projects.

A.The Oklahoma Department of Commerce shall promulgate rules for purposes of establishing criteria for the funding of authorized infrastructure projects from the proceeds of obligations issued by the Oklahoma Development Finance Authority for the Public-Private Partner Development Pool.
B.The Department shall establish a scoring system to evaluate projects to be financed from the proceeds of obligations issued by the Authority for the Public-Private Partner Development Pool.
